The NSW marriage certificates from that time usually have information relating to where the bride and groom were born, and their parents names plus more, so you may have to obtain the certificate to advance your research, that is if you haven't already.

NSW Death certificates list the amount of time the person has lived in Australia, so this is always the best place to start.

Anne the cheapest way to get details of certificates in NSW is to get a transcription agent.
http://www.bdm.nsw.gov.au/familyHistory/howToSearch.htm#TranscriptionAgent
NSW Civil registration didn't start until 1856, so prior to that only church records are available. Thus said, I have a marriage certificate from 1873, where most of the information was omitted, but most of my NSW certificates, especially death certificates, have had all the information.
I use Laurie Turtle for my transcriptions. He also goes to the State Records and will transcribe the shipping records - also at a lesser fee (I think - you would need to check prices) than the copy rate from State Records.
Sometimes there is more information on the shipping records - sometimes very little.
